    If you are mixing different vegetables on the pan, you will want to make sure they finish cooking in the same amount of time. Here are some tips: 1. Round Root Vegetables(Beets, Sweet Potatoes, Potatoes). Cut these vegetables on the smaller size (about 3/4-inch pieces), as they tend to take longer to roast. 2.     Use a High Temperature. The best temperature for roasting vegetables is 400 degrees F. If you have convection oven, use the bake setting and reduce to 375 degrees F.
    Don’t Crowd the Pan. Vegetables need to roast in a single layer without overlapping one another on the baking sheet. This will allow the air to circulate and crisp the outsides (otherwise, the vegg...
    Use Enough Olive Oil. Oil is necessary for the vegetables to caramelize. If you skimp when you drizzle, the vegetables will burn and taste dry.
    Rotate the Pan(s). Halfway through the baking time, rotate the pan 180 degrees, especially if your oven doesn’t bake evenly and absolutely if you are using convection.
    Spicy Roasted Vegetables. Season with 1/2 teaspoon chipotle chile powder (more if you like super spicy!), or regular chili powder plus cayenne.
    Cheesy Roasted Vegetables. Sprinkle the roasted vegetables with freshly grated cheddar, mozzarella, gruyere, or Parmesan cheese. Pop back into the oven for a few minutes to melt.
    Garlic Roasted Vegetables. Season with garlic powder or add a few cloves of thinly sliced garlic to the roasting pan.
    Citrus Roasted Vegetables. Add thin lemon slices or orange slices to the pan with the vegetables. Finish with a squeeze of fresh lemon juice or orange juice.

    To Store. Refrigerate leftovers in an airtight storage container for up to 5 days.
    To Reheat. Rewarm vegetables on a baking sheet in the oven at 350 degrees F or in the microwave.
